{"id":"https://openalex.org/W7119516803","doi":"https://doi.org/10.1145/3779031.3779085","title":"Mechanizing Synthetic Tait Computability in Istari","display_name":"Mechanizing Synthetic Tait Computability in Istari","publication_year":2026,"publication_date":"2026-01-08","ids":{"openalex":"https://openalex.org/W7119516803","doi":"https://doi.org/10.1145/3779031.3779085"},"language":null,"primary_location":{"id":"doi:10.1145/3779031.3779085","is_oa":false,"landing_page_url":"https://doi.org/10.1145/3779031.3779085","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 15th ACM SIGPLAN International Conference on Certified Programs and Proofs","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5113073994","display_name":"Runming Li","orcid":null},"institutions":[{"id":"https://openalex.org/I74973139","display_name":"Carnegie Mellon University","ror":"https://ror.org/05x2bcf33","country_code":"US","type":"education","lineage":["https://openalex.org/I74973139"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Runming Li","raw_affiliation_strings":["Carnegie Mellon University, Pittsburgh, USA"],"affiliations":[{"raw_affiliation_string":"Carnegie Mellon University, Pittsburgh, USA","institution_ids":["https://openalex.org/I74973139"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5122374561","display_name":"Yue Yao","orcid":null},"institutions":[{"id":"https://openalex.org/I74973139","display_name":"Carnegie Mellon University","ror":"https://ror.org/05x2bcf33","country_code":"US","type":"education","lineage":["https://openalex.org/I74973139"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Yue Yao","raw_affiliation_strings":["Carnegie Mellon University, Pittsburgh, USA"],"affiliations":[{"raw_affiliation_string":"Carnegie Mellon University, Pittsburgh, USA","institution_ids":["https://openalex.org/I74973139"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5069269813","display_name":"R. Harper","orcid":null},"institutions":[{"id":"https://openalex.org/I74973139","display_name":"Carnegie Mellon University","ror":"https://ror.org/05x2bcf33","country_code":"US","type":"education","lineage":["https://openalex.org/I74973139"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Robert Harper","raw_affiliation_strings":["Carnegie Mellon University, Pittsburgh, USA"],"affiliations":[{"raw_affiliation_string":"Carnegie Mellon University, Pittsburgh, USA","institution_ids":["https://openalex.org/I74973139"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":3,"corresponding_author_ids":["https://openalex.org/A5113073994"],"corresponding_institution_ids":["https://openalex.org/I74973139"],"apc_list":null,"apc_paid":null,"fwci":0.0,"has_fulltext":false,"cited_by_count":0,"citation_normalized_percentile":{"value":0.1172209,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":null,"biblio":{"volume":null,"issue":null,"first_page":"231","last_page":"247"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10126","display_name":"Logic, programming, and type systems","score":0.9099000096321106,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10126","display_name":"Logic, programming, and type systems","score":0.9099000096321106,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T12002","display_name":"Computability, Logic, AI Algorithms","score":0.028200000524520874,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10142","display_name":"Formal Methods in Verification","score":0.011900000274181366,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computability","display_name":"Computability","score":0.5582000017166138},{"id":"https://openalex.org/keywords/modal-logic","display_name":"Modal logic","score":0.5257999897003174},{"id":"https://openalex.org/keywords/type-theory","display_name":"Type theory","score":0.5162000060081482},{"id":"https://openalex.org/keywords/extension","display_name":"Extension (predicate logic)","score":0.4731000065803528},{"id":"https://openalex.org/keywords/categorical-variable","display_name":"Categorical variable","score":0.4659000039100647},{"id":"https://openalex.org/keywords/conservative-extension","display_name":"Conservative extension","score":0.4634000062942505},{"id":"https://openalex.org/keywords/proof-theory","display_name":"Proof theory","score":0.45899999141693115},{"id":"https://openalex.org/keywords/type","display_name":"Type (biology)","score":0.44850000739097595},{"id":"https://openalex.org/keywords/logical-framework","display_name":"Logical framework","score":0.4399000108242035},{"id":"https://openalex.org/keywords/extensional-definition","display_name":"Extensional definition","score":0.43560001254081726}],"concepts":[{"id":"https://openalex.org/C152062344","wikidata":"https://www.wikidata.org/wiki/Q818888","display_name":"Computability","level":2,"score":0.5582000017166138},{"id":"https://openalex.org/C27508121","wikidata":"https://www.wikidata.org/wiki/Q210841","display_name":"Modal logic","level":3,"score":0.5257999897003174},{"id":"https://openalex.org/C93682546","wikidata":"https://www.wikidata.org/wiki/Q1056428","display_name":"Type theory","level":3,"score":0.5162000060081482},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.5037000179290771},{"id":"https://openalex.org/C2778029271","wikidata":"https://www.wikidata.org/wiki/Q5421931","display_name":"Extension (predicate logic)","level":2,"score":0.4731000065803528},{"id":"https://openalex.org/C5274069","wikidata":"https://www.wikidata.org/wiki/Q2285707","display_name":"Categorical variable","level":2,"score":0.4659000039100647},{"id":"https://openalex.org/C2780432614","wikidata":"https://www.wikidata.org/wiki/Q864213","display_name":"Conservative extension","level":2,"score":0.4634000062942505},{"id":"https://openalex.org/C2318724","wikidata":"https://www.wikidata.org/wiki/Q852732","display_name":"Proof theory","level":3,"score":0.45899999141693115},{"id":"https://openalex.org/C2777299769","wikidata":"https://www.wikidata.org/wiki/Q3707858","display_name":"Type (biology)","level":2,"score":0.44850000739097595},{"id":"https://openalex.org/C20693621","wikidata":"https://www.wikidata.org/wiki/Q6667502","display_name":"Logical framework","level":2,"score":0.4399000108242035},{"id":"https://openalex.org/C136137745","wikidata":"https://www.wikidata.org/wiki/Q19515659","display_name":"Extensional definition","level":3,"score":0.43560001254081726},{"id":"https://openalex.org/C2164484","wikidata":"https://www.wikidata.org/wiki/Q5170150","display_name":"Core (optical fiber)","level":2,"score":0.42980000376701355},{"id":"https://openalex.org/C2777686260","wikidata":"https://www.wikidata.org/wiki/Q144037","display_name":"Calculus (dental)","level":2,"score":0.3978999853134155},{"id":"https://openalex.org/C11191006","wikidata":"https://www.wikidata.org/wiki/Q2663311","display_name":"Accessibility relation","level":4,"score":0.3953000009059906},{"id":"https://openalex.org/C2778698498","wikidata":"https://www.wikidata.org/wiki/Q1207152","display_name":"Elegance","level":2,"score":0.391400009393692},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.3865000009536743},{"id":"https://openalex.org/C136119220","wikidata":"https://www.wikidata.org/wiki/Q1000660","display_name":"Algebra over a field","level":2,"score":0.3799999952316284},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.37380000948905945},{"id":"https://openalex.org/C118615104","wikidata":"https://www.wikidata.org/wiki/Q121416","display_name":"Discrete mathematics","level":1,"score":0.3677999973297119},{"id":"https://openalex.org/C20528804","wikidata":"https://www.wikidata.org/wiki/Q997433","display_name":"Dependent type","level":3,"score":0.3580999970436096},{"id":"https://openalex.org/C47030870","wikidata":"https://www.wikidata.org/wiki/Q467606","display_name":"Model theory","level":2,"score":0.3393999934196472},{"id":"https://openalex.org/C160131679","wikidata":"https://www.wikidata.org/wiki/Q2462350","display_name":"Kripke semantics","level":4,"score":0.3183000087738037},{"id":"https://openalex.org/C62073222","wikidata":"https://www.wikidata.org/wiki/Q1572108","display_name":"Natural deduction","level":2,"score":0.3176000118255615},{"id":"https://openalex.org/C178421362","wikidata":"https://www.wikidata.org/wiki/Q176786","display_name":"Intuitionistic logic","level":3,"score":0.30000001192092896},{"id":"https://openalex.org/C18762648","wikidata":"https://www.wikidata.org/wiki/Q42213","display_name":"Work (physics)","level":2,"score":0.2994999885559082},{"id":"https://openalex.org/C71139939","wikidata":"https://www.wikidata.org/wiki/Q910194","display_name":"Modal","level":2,"score":0.2964000105857849},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.28949999809265137},{"id":"https://openalex.org/C192609573","wikidata":"https://www.wikidata.org/wiki/Q7388341","display_name":"S5","level":5,"score":0.2856999933719635},{"id":"https://openalex.org/C203265346","wikidata":"https://www.wikidata.org/wiki/Q11387554","display_name":"Proof assistant","level":3,"score":0.2777999937534332},{"id":"https://openalex.org/C134752490","wikidata":"https://www.wikidata.org/wiki/Q374182","display_name":"Logical consequence","level":2,"score":0.26010000705718994},{"id":"https://openalex.org/C2780366209","wikidata":"https://www.wikidata.org/wiki/Q5170200","display_name":"Core model","level":2,"score":0.2581000030040741},{"id":"https://openalex.org/C69562738","wikidata":"https://www.wikidata.org/wiki/Q200694","display_name":"Propositional calculus","level":2,"score":0.2540000081062317},{"id":"https://openalex.org/C65880906","wikidata":"https://www.wikidata.org/wiki/Q1771121","display_name":"Sequent calculus","level":3,"score":0.25200000405311584},{"id":"https://openalex.org/C153046414","wikidata":"https://www.wikidata.org/wiki/Q12482","display_name":"Set theory","level":3,"score":0.2502000033855438}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1145/3779031.3779085","is_oa":false,"landing_page_url":"https://doi.org/10.1145/3779031.3779085","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 15th ACM SIGPLAN International Conference on Certified Programs and Proofs","raw_type":"proceedings-article"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":57,"referenced_works":["https://openalex.org/W49202426","https://openalex.org/W1527324030","https://openalex.org/W1974190112","https://openalex.org/W1977189131","https://openalex.org/W2044680615","https://openalex.org/W2056024754","https://openalex.org/W2095631859","https://openalex.org/W2107674601","https://openalex.org/W2120905340","https://openalex.org/W2124798629","https://openalex.org/W2133629640","https://openalex.org/W2133639043","https://openalex.org/W2167949883","https://openalex.org/W2550513301","https://openalex.org/W2556917400","https://openalex.org/W2779668776","https://openalex.org/W2780835401","https://openalex.org/W2810208141","https://openalex.org/W2883252932","https://openalex.org/W2887657530","https://openalex.org/W2888153140","https://openalex.org/W2888798587","https://openalex.org/W2900009437","https://openalex.org/W2902687082","https://openalex.org/W2907081672","https://openalex.org/W2963233543","https://openalex.org/W2963775463","https://openalex.org/W2963795353","https://openalex.org/W2981188613","https://openalex.org/W2995917016","https://openalex.org/W2999721086","https://openalex.org/W3019110569","https://openalex.org/W3095227982","https://openalex.org/W3114212704","https://openalex.org/W3118363023","https://openalex.org/W3168820674","https://openalex.org/W3175425481","https://openalex.org/W3202721349","https://openalex.org/W4205724670","https://openalex.org/W4206010916","https://openalex.org/W4206229704","https://openalex.org/W4220961328","https://openalex.org/W4291668274","https://openalex.org/W4305030140","https://openalex.org/W4384389850","https://openalex.org/W4386317139","https://openalex.org/W4390604919","https://openalex.org/W4390777456","https://openalex.org/W4405286881","https://openalex.org/W4412308858","https://openalex.org/W4412989140","https://openalex.org/W4416156708","https://openalex.org/W4417089133","https://openalex.org/W7083011706","https://openalex.org/W7108463704","https://openalex.org/W7109589747","https://openalex.org/W7119492379"],"related_works":[],"abstract_inverted_index":{"Categorical":[0],"gluing":[1,28,33],"is":[2,58],"a":[3,36,42,48,59,84,107,124],"powerful":[4],"technique":[5],"for":[6,87,110,128],"proving":[7],"meta-theorems":[8],"of":[9,25,50,70,151],"type":[10,39,62,112],"theories":[11],"such":[12],"as":[13],"canonicity":[14,108,126],"and":[15,95,99,117,122],"normalization.":[16],"Synthetic":[17],"Tait":[18],"Computability":[19],"(STC)":[20],"provides":[21],"an":[22],"abstract":[23],"treatment":[24],"the":[26,32,53,71,129,137,149,152],"complex":[27],"models":[29],"by":[30],"internalizing":[31],"category":[34],"into":[35],"modal":[37],"dependent":[38,111,115],"theory":[40,63,113],"with":[41,64,114,119],"phase":[43,89],"distinction.":[44],"This":[45,81],"work":[46,82],"presents":[47],"mechanization":[49],"STC":[51,139],"in":[52,77,146],"Istari":[54,57],"proof":[55,79],"assistant.":[56],"Martin-L'of-style":[60],"extensional":[61],"equality":[65],"reflection,":[66],"which":[67],"avoids":[68],"much":[69],"explicit":[72],"transport":[73],"reasoning":[74],"typically":[75],"found":[76],"intensional":[78],"assistants.":[80],"develops":[83],"reusable":[85],"library":[86],"synthetic":[88],"distinction,":[90],"including":[91],"modalities,":[92],"extension":[93],"types,":[94,98],"strict":[96],"glue":[97],"applies":[100],"it":[101],"to":[102],"two":[103],"case":[104],"studies:":[105],"(1)":[106],"model":[109,127],"products":[116],"booleans":[118],"large":[120],"elimination,":[121],"(2)":[123],"Kripke":[125],"cost-aware":[130],"logical":[131],"framework.":[132],"Our":[133],"results":[134],"demonstrate":[135],"that":[136],"core":[138],"constructions":[140],"can":[141],"be":[142],"formalized":[143],"essentially":[144],"verbatim":[145],"Istari,":[147],"preserving":[148],"elegance":[150],"on-paper":[153],"arguments":[154],"while":[155],"ensuring":[156],"machine-checked":[157],"correctness.":[158]},"counts_by_year":[],"updated_date":"2026-01-09T23:14:04.187858","created_date":"2026-01-09T00:00:00"}
